Begin your adventure by immersing yourself in the cultural treasures of Hanoi, the capital city of Vietnam. In the morning, explore the historical Hoan Kiem Lake, surrounded by charming temples and the iconic red Huc Bridge. Take a cyclo ride through the bustling Old Quarter, with its narrow winding streets filled with shops and markets. Enjoy a traditional Vietnamese lunch at a local eatery, savoring the delicious flavors of pho or bun cha. Spend the afternoon discovering the fascinating history at the Vietnam Museum of Ethnology. As the evening sets in, head to the Thang Long Water Puppet Theater for a mesmerizing show of traditional puppetry.
Embark on an unforgettable cruise to Halong Bay, a UNESCO World Heritage Site known for its breathtaking limestone karsts. Enjoy a morning drive to Halong City, where you'll board a traditional junk boat and set sail among the stunning islands and islets. Feast on a delicious seafood lunch as you glide through the turquoise waters. Explore some of the hidden caves and grottoes that dot the bay, marveling at their natural beauty. Spend the afternoon kayaking around the karsts or simply relaxing on the sundeck, taking in the awe-inspiring scenery. As the sun sets, indulge in a sumptuous dinner onboard, accompanied by panoramic views of this mesmerizing bay.
Travel to the enchanting city of Hoi An, known for its well-preserved ancient town and charming mix of Vietnamese, Chinese, and Japanese influences. Begin your day by exploring the UNESCO-listed Hoi An Ancient Town, strolling through its narrow streets adorned with colorful lanterns. Visit the iconic Japanese Covered Bridge and the ancient Chua Cau pagoda. Enjoy a traditional Vietnamese lunch at a riverside restaurant, sampling local specialties such as cao lau or white rose dumplings. In the afternoon, take a bicycle ride to the nearby Tra Que Vegetable Village, where you can learn about traditional farming practices and even try your hand at farming. As the evening approaches, immerse yourself in the magical atmosphere of Hoi An's lantern-lit streets.
Discover the imperial city of Hue,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, known for its grand palaces, pagodas, and royal tombs. Start your day by visiting the imposing Citadel, with its majestic Ngo Mon Gate and Thai Hoa Palace. Explore the beautiful temple complexes of Thien Mu Pagoda and Tu Duc Tomb, marveling at the intricate architecture and serene surroundings. Enjoy a traditional Hue-style lunch featuring dishes like banh khoai or banh beo. Afterward, take a relaxing boat ride along the Perfume River, soaking in the scenic beauty as you pass by lush green landscapes. In the evening, savor a royal-style dinner, indulging in culinary delights fit for kings and queens.
Conclude your Vietnam journey by immersing yourself in the vibrant energy of Ho Chi Minh City, formerly known as Saigon. Start the day by exploring the historic landmarks of the Reunification Palace and Notre-Dame Cathedral, reminders of the city's colonial past. Visit the War Remnants Museum to gain insights into the Vietnam War and its impact. Enjoy a delicious Vietnamese lunch at a local eatery, savoring dishes like banh xeo or bo la lot. Spend the afternoon indulging in retail therapy at the bustling Ben Thanh Market, where you can find a wide range of souvenirs, handicrafts, and local delicacies. In the evening, experience the city's lively nightlife and enjoy a rooftop dinner with panoramic views of Ho Chi Minh City.
While popular attractions are a must-visit, exploring Vietnam's hidden gems and local favorites will add a unique touch to your trip. Head to Phong Nha-Ke Bang National Park to witness stunning caves and underground rivers. Explore the beautiful landscapes of Sapa and meet ethnic minority groups. Visit the floating markets in the Mekong Delta, where you can experience the vibrant river culture. Don't miss the chance to sample Bánh mì, a delicious Vietnamese sandwich, and indulge in a traditional Vietnamese coffee at a local cafe.
